TICKET: Fuel vault locked — fleet report blocked. The Q3 fuel-usage report for the Harkwell Logistics fleet can't be generated because the Tallow vault sealed itself after three failed unlocks. You're new, so: don't retry, it extends the lockout. Pull the exported CSV from the staging mirror if urgent. To reseed the vault, use the recovery passphrase below.

recovery phrase for fahap-haduf: casvan-eliius-novmir-holiel-oliwyn-brivan-gilax-gilael-gilax-wenius-rusael-istius-ralys-julwyn

Handover — Pellmont SDK parity. The Tidewell Go SDK now matches the Kotlin client on retries, pagination, and webhook verification; only streaming uploads remain behind a flag. Parity tests live in the cross-client suite and run nightly. Future maintainers: keep the two changelogs in lockstep, and never ship a method in one SDK without filing a parity ticket for the other. Signing access for release artifacts requires unsealing the shared keystore, using the passphrase below.

vault phrase of tawip-faweg = fraok-holdor-zorwyn-belox-ulador-aldix-quenael-lamox-juleth-lamion

## Formula sandbox tuning

User-supplied formulas in Gridmoor execute inside a restricted interpreter with hard ceilings on time, memory, and call depth. Reviewers should confirm any change to these ceilings is justified in the PR description, since raising them widens the abuse surface. Defaults were chosen from production traces. The current limits are as follows.

limits module of tafog-fawip:
WEIGHTS = {
    "julix": 57,
    "lamys": 992,
    "kasvan": 209,
    "quenok": 750,
    "alddor": 259,
    "oliath": 1009,
    "wenix": 815,
}